The Performance Assurance Specialist Team at CCG is a big reason why our customers enjoy the most comfortable buildings with the lowest energy consumption in their respective market.  The Team is the final step in our installation process and is responsible for validating that all systems are operating according to CCG’s rigorous Sequences of Operation. In addition to the controls, the Team also reviews the mechanical systems, certain electrical systems, metering and building envelope.

Roles and Responsibilities
As part of the Performance Assurance team, you are responsible for ensuring all control systems installed by CCG are operating properly to provide our clients with an energy-efficient, high-performance building. Your time will be split 80/20 with the majority being spent on-site working with building systems, and the remaining time spent inside the CCG office.

The ideal candidate is independent, systems and process-oriented, and customer service focused who is well versed in all aspects of HVAC Building Automation\Energy Management\Systems Integrations\DDC and has Tridium Niagara certification.  Additionally, this candidate will understand advanced control systems, sequence of operations, IT networks, and smart HVAC equipment.  You need to be able to:

  • Checkout mechanical and controls equipment and verify it meets CCG standards.  
  • Verify software is working in sync with controls system.
    • Validate these efforts through analysis using EPA’s Energy Star Portfolio Manager
  • Ensure alarms are being generated and sent to proper location.
  • Communicate with customers regularly to review building and service needs and be fully committed to ensuring all customers receive the highest level of service.
  • Perform on-site continuous validation on both projects and service contracts.
  • Perform calibrations and monitor and fine-tune WebCTRL systems to ensure optimum performance standards are being achieved.
  • Use trending in the building automation system to assist you with any fine-tuning that may be required.  
  • Review the controls submittals to ensure the systems designed will meet the project requirements.
  • Work collaboratively with Engineering, Installation and Service departments to ensure customers receive the highest standard of service in the industry.   This includes providing feedback and training to the other departments on ways to implement projects more efficiently
  • Troubleshoot using industry tools that include a thermal scanner, air-balancing tools, meters, etc. 
  • Provide prompt responses to any external or internal requests for information. This may include developing and continually updating an Open Items List for issues that may need to be addressed by CCG, the design team or other trades.
  • Identify additional opportunities for building enhancements and make appropriate recommendations to customers (i.e. HVAC repairs, etc.)
